    Interaction with the Probationary IPS Officers (7.1.2016)

    Shri O.P. Kohli, Hon. Governorshri, interacted with five Probationary IPS Officers who called on him at the Raj

    Bhavan, Gandhinagar, on 7.1.2016 as part of a courtesy visit.

    Hon. Governorshri had a detailed interaction with the Probationary Officers. He inquired about their training

    modules and discussed with them about their role as public servants in the service of the society. He also gave them

    his good wishes and blessings and expressed the hope that they would serve the State as well as the country with the

    best of their abilities, dedication and sincerity.

    Release of the Sanskrit translation of Mahatma Gandhiji's Book entitled VGF;LsT IMU translated from Gujarati into Sanskrit by Dr. Gautam Patel, a renowned Sanskrit Scholar, at a function organized by the Sanskrit Seva Samiti, Ahmedabad at the Raj Bhavan, Gandhinagar (9.1.2016)

    Shri O.P. Kohli, Hon. Governorshri, released the Sanskrit translation of Mahatma Gandhiji's book named

    VGF;LsT IMU translated from Gujarati into Sanskrit by Dr. Gautam Patel.In his brief address to the distinguished gathering on the occasion, Shri O.P. Kohli, Hon. Governorshri, observed

    that Mahatma Gandhiji's book on VGF;LsT IMU contains his interpretation of the philosophy of Yoga in a very simple and heart-touching language. He further stated that Dr. Gautam Patel had done a great service to the society

    by translating it in Sanskrit for the use of the Sanskrit lovers of the present and future generations. He complimented

    Uttaranchal Sanskrit University for publishing this book.

    The programme was attended by Sanskrit scholars, religious leaders, prominent Gandhians, Sanskrit lovers,

    academicians and all others interested in Gandhiji's ideology.

    Lohri Celebrations in the Raj Bhavan, Gandhinagar (13.1.2016)

    The festival of Lohri was celebrated in the lawns of the Raj Bhavan, Gandhinagar on 13.1.2016 in the evening. A

    bonfire was lit around sun-set and Shri O.P. Kohli, Hon. Governorshri and Smt. Avinash Kohli, Hon. Lady

    Governorshri, their family members and the staff members of the Raj Bhavan accompanied by their family members,

    worshipped the bonfire. Younger children danced around the bonfire and performed a few garba steps on the

    occasion.

    Release of the book entitled Kitchen Queen written bySmt. Maya Surana, in the Raj Bhavan, Gandhinagar (13.1.2016)

    Shri O.P. Kohli, Hon. Governorshri, released the book entitled Kitchen Queen written by Smt. Maya Surana at a

    function organized by the Anekant Bharati Publication, Ahmedabad, at a programme held in the Raj Bhavan,

    Gandhinagar.

    While releasing the book, Shri O.P. Kohli, Hon. Governorshri, observed that Smt. Maya deserved compliments for

    bringing out a book on cooking which would prove to be of a great help to the women folk in preparing a variety of

    items in their homes. He appreciated her efforts and expressed the hope that Smt. Maya Surana would continue to

    bring out more publications for the day-to-day use of our women folk.

    The programme was attended by prominent women activists, culinary experts, office bearers of the Anekant

    Bharati Publication, Ahmedabad, and the well-wishers of Smt. Maya Surana in large number.

    'At Home' Ceremony for the NCC Cadets at the

    Raj Bhavan, Gandhinagar (3.2.2016)Shri O.P. Kohli, Hon. Governorshri, graced the 'At Home' ceremony for the

    Gujarat NCC Contingents which had participated in the Republic Day Parade at

    New Delhi. The programme was organized by the NCC Directorate of Gujarat,

    Dadra Nagar Haveli, Diu and Daman at the Raj Bhavan, Gandhinagar on

    3.2.2016.

    Shri O.P. Kohli, Hon. Governorshri, felicitated a few NCC cadets with

    medals for their outstanding performance during the Republic Day parade at

    New Delhi. He complimented them for their achievements and expressed

    the hope that they would continue to shine out in their future endeavours.

    In his address to the NCC cadets assembled on the occasion, Shri O.P. Kohli,

    Hon. Governorshri, expressed his pleasure for being with them and

    observed that their excellent performance at the Republic Day Parade had

    given credit to the Gujarat State. He praised their hard work and commitment

    to the NCC. He also called upon the young cadets to serve the nation without

    prejudice and spread the message of spirit of unity and secularism in their life.

    He also stated that the lessons of discipline and unity that they have learnt in the

    NCC, would help them to be ideal citizens of the country in future.

    He also watched with interest a small cultural programme that was staged by

    the NCC cadets during the event.

    The programme was attended by Shri Bhupendrasinhji Chudasma, Hon.

    Education Minister, Professor Vasuben Trivedi, Hon. Minister of State for

    Education, Major General Sanjeev Shukla, Additional Director General -

    NCC, Senior Officers of the NCC, Vice Chancellors of a few universities,

    NCC cadets and their parents in large number.

  • Shri Ramayyagari Subhash Reddy as theChief Justice of the Gujarat High Court (13.2.2016)

    Shri Justice Ramayyagari Subhash Reddy,

    Hon. Judge of the High Court of Judicature at

    Hyderabad for the State of Telengana and the

    State of Andhra Pradesh, was appointed as the

    Chief Justice of the Gujarat High Court with

    effect from the date he assumed charge of his

    office vide the Government of India in the

    Ministry of Law and Justice's Notification

    dated 30.1.2016.

    Shri O.P. Kohli, Hon. Governorshri of

    Gujarat, administered oath of office to Shri

    Justice Ramayyagari Subhash Reddy as the

    Chief Justice of the Gujarat High Court at a

    function held in the Raj Bhavan lawns at

    Gandhinagar on 13.2.2016.

    Smt. Anandiben Patel, Hon. Chief Minister

    of Gujarat, Shri Ganpat Vasava, Hon. Speaker

    of the Gujarat Legislative Assembly, Cabinet

    Ministers, retired Judges from the Supreme

    Court and Gujarat High Court, eminent

    lawyers and senior bureaucrats from the State

    administration remained present during the

    event.

  • Shri Balwant Singh, IAS (Retd), Chief Information Commissioner, Gujarat State, accompanied

    by Shri V.S. Gadhvi, IAS, (Retd), Information Commissioner and others came to the Raj Bhavan,

    Gandhinagar, on 22.3.2016 and handed over the Gujarat Information Commission's Annual Report

    2014-15. Hon. Governorshri accepted the Report.

    The Report under the Right To Information Act, 2005 mentions about the Commission's activities

    such as statistical data about the complaints received and complaints disposed off in the year 2014-

    15. It also gives the Commission's recommendations and suggestions as well as observations for the

    better implementation of the Right To Information Act, 2005.

    After going through the contents of the Report, Hon. Governorshri allowed it to be forwarded to

    the State Government in the General Administration Department for placing it before the Gujarat

    Legislative Assembly.

    Shri O.P. Kohli, Hon. Governorshri, gave away the Sanskrit Gaurav Puraskar Award and the Yuva Gaurav Puraskar Award to the Sanskrit scholars at a function organized by the Gujarat Sahitya Academy, Gandhinagar, at the Raj Bhavan, Gandhinagar, on 30.3.2016.

    Hon. Governorshri felicitated Dr. Ambalal Prajapati, a renowned Sanskrit scholar with the Sanskrit Gaurav Puraskar Award and Shri Gopal Upadyay, a promising scholar of the Sanskrit, with the Yuva Gaurav Puraskar Award during the event. Both the awardees represented two different generations in the sense that Dr. Ambalal Prajapati was a veteran Sanskrit scholar who had devoted his entire life for the spread of Sanskrit; whereas, Shri Gopal Upahdyay represented the younger generation who had shown remarkable performance for the spread of Sanskrit at a very young age. Hon. Governorshri complimented both the scholars and wished them good luck in their future endeavours. The programme was attended by Shri Nanubhai Vanani, Hon. Minister of State for Sports, Youth and Cultural Activities, academicians, prominent citizens of Ahmedabad and Gandhinagar, literary figures and lovers of Sanskrit in large number.

  • Inauguration of the Gujarati

    Literature Festival 2016 organized

    by the Gujarati Literature Fest, Ahmedabad at

    Ahmedabad (6.1.2016)

    Shri O.P. Kohli, Hon. Governorshri, inaugurated the

    Gujarati Literature Festival 2016 which was organized by

    the Gujarati Literature Fest, Ahmedabad at the Kanodia

    Centre for Art, K.L. Campus, Opp. Gujarat University,

    Ahmedabad on 6.1.2016. In his inaugural address, Shri O.P.

    Kohli, Hon. Governorshri, observed that the purpose of the

    celebration of the Gujarati Literature Festival was to revive

    interest for literature particularly in our youths and thereby to

    promote love for Gujarati language in every possible way.

    He further stated that the Gujarati writers have been

    presenting modern life and its problems in new and different

    forms and their efforts have made Gujarati literature more

    relevant today. He stated that Gujarati literature has never

    remained static as it has been undergoing constant changes

    and has been evolving over a period of time.

    Hon. Governorshri felicitated Shri Raghuveer Chaudhary,

    the winner of 51st Jnanpith Award, for his outstanding

    contribution to Gujarati literature.

    The programme was attended by Shri Raghveer

    Chaudhary, Lord Meghnath Desai, eminent Gujarati writers,

    prominent literary figures, academicians and all those who

    are interested in promoting the cause of modern Gujarati

    literature.

    Inauguration of theSatvik Food Mahotsav

    jointly organizedby the

    SRISTI and theIndian Institute of

    Management (IIM),Ahmedabad (9.1.2016)

    Shri O.P. Kohli, Hon. Governorshri, inaugurated the 13th edition of 3-Days long Satvik Food Festival

    hosted by the Society for Research and Initiatives for Substantial Technologies and Inspiration (SRISTI)

    and the Indian Institute of Management (IIM), Ahmedabad. In his inaugural address, Shri O.P. Kohli,

    Hon. Governorshri, observed that the main objective of the Satvik Food Festival was to promote

    traditional recipes which were made with lesser-known grains, vegetables and minor millets. He observed

    that it was a matter of pleasure that a number of edible food items from across the country were

    demonstrated during the event.

    Hon. Governorshri had further observed that the idea of the Satvik Food Festival was to take people back

    to their roots and renew their interests in our forgotten traditional recipes besides making them aware of

    lesser-known forgotten food-grains and millets from several States. He asked the people to remember that by

    taking traditional food, we do not become backward. He impressed upon the people that we should never

    treat our regular diet as old-fashioned and out of date. Rather, we should always remember our diets with our

    roots and should proudly love our traditional food.

    The programme was attended by Shri Ashish Nanda, Director of the Indian Institute of Management,

    Ahmedabad, Prof. Anil Gupta and other dignitaries, food lovers and prominent people from all walks of life.
